What are Questionnaires for?
4
Questionnaire
• Used to represent forms/surveys/case report forms/etc.• Can capture any sort of information
• clinical, administrative, financial, research, public health, …
• Hierarchical collections of questions• May include ‘groups’ and instructions/guidance• Control over allowed answer optionality, repetition, data type, options• Some elements might be conditional
• e.g. “if question 2=female, then display question 5”
5
QuestionnaireResponse
• A single (fully or partially) completed form• Ties to exactly one Questionnaire• Lets you see and compare “raw” data• Can’t be used for direct query based on answer values
• Too hard to manage context implicit in instructions/other questions
• Data is not comparable if captured based on different Questionnaires
Example
• Questionnaire question:• “When were you born?” Answer: string• “How old are you (in years)?” Answer: integer/decimal• “How old are you?” Answer:
(a) 0-18; (b) 19-30; (c) 31-50; (d) 51+• “What was your birth year?” Answer: integer
“What was your birth month?” Answer: integer• Etc.
• Patient question:• Patient.birthDate? Answer: date (yyyy, yyyy-mm, yyyy-mm-dd)
Questionnaire usage
• Questionnaire• Raw data capture or tight control over display• Retain “source of truth” for data• Generic mechanism for non-FHIR aware systems
• Other resources• Search• Decision support• Consistency of representation independent of source
• In many cases, you may need both
What is SDC?
9
Original Structured Data Capture (SDC)
• U.S. Office of the National Coordinator for Healthcare (ONC) initiated project
• Parallel efforts in IHE (custom schema) and FHIR• FHIR effort had 2 focuses
• Standardizing the sharing of data elements (IS 11179-aligned)• Supporting standardization of Questionnaire usage and enabling pre-
population and auto-population
• Separate FHIR IGs created for each
10
SDC Phase II
• Funded by US National Library of Medicine• Scope:
• Update the SDC implementation guide to align with R4• Make the IG international in scope• Add new rendering/control capabilities• Figure out a population/extraction mechanism that’s workable
• Targeting Standard for Trial Use (STU) ballot opening in April
Why SDC?
• Base FHIR resources • almost everything optional• Focus is “what do most systems do?”
• Most systems includes lots of very limited systems• Provides base level interoperability across all systems
• SDC implementation guide• Sets “higher” expectations for systems dealing with more sophisticated forms• Provides confidence that forms will be rendered and will capture data as
intended
SDC defines 6 things
• Standard workflow models and roles for managing, discovering and completing forms
• Sophisticated rendering capabilities• Sophisticated behavior/flow control capabilities• Pre-populate/auto-populate forms• Extract resources from forms• Adaptive forms
• Systems choose what to adapt
Capabilities defined by
• Describing conformance expectations around existing extensions• Defining new extensions• Documenting (and providing examples) showing how the capabilities
can be used for real-world healthcare scenarios
Where can SDC be useful?
• Submitting forms for clinical research• Submitting public health forms• Submitting and processing electronic insurance claims (pre-
authorizations, special authorizations, etc.)• Any area where questionnaires/forms are a standard mechanism for
data collection

Form population
• Don’t make user fill in what’s already in the EHR/other systems• Contents of forms must be “computably” derivable from standardized
data• SDC Phase II focus is FHIR-based data, not CDA
Multiple population levels
• Full population: Answer automatically filled in• E.g. Patient’s name, gender, address
• Choice selection: Possible choices for answer• E.g. “List all potentially relevant concomitant medications”
• Answer context: Information to help user formulate an answer• E.g. “Has the patient had similar procedures in the past?”
3 data representation approaches
• Observation-based• Question/group tied to specific question code (e.g. LOINC)
• FHIRPath based• Pass in context (Patient, Encounter, other?)• Perform queries to set context for Questionnaire/group• FHIRPath to calculate variables• Question/group context tied to specific FHIRPath
• StructureMap• Formal mapping from QuestionnaireResponse to completed Questionnaire
Extraction
• User has filled in a Questionnaire• How do I make that data available to:
• Decision support• Available using standard profiles (Argonaut, Australian core, etc.)• Discoverable by queries?
• Need to move data into “regular” resources• Observation, Encounter, MedicationStatement, etc.
• $extract operation
Extraction approach
• Leverage same technologies as population• Observation• StructureDefinition
• Also support “Definition”-based• Link questions/groups to particular profiles and profile elements
Adaptive forms
• Hide the complexity of the questionnaire logic• Hit the server with “answers so far”• Server returns an updated questionnaire adding one more question• Supported by Argonaut Questionnaire
• $nextQuestion operation
